Output c031a581f2b4f67cd4967954ebe38b9ad541f9197e7ce4cdaa2dd1cacc70426c:51

value
21178385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ebb68342d47b68573c881bb2d7283756dbefe337 OP_EQUAL
address
3PBMMqAiE2HWPTLGFLxJwVbv1kfa8gqB8u
transaction
c031a581f2b4f67cd4967954ebe38b9ad541f9197e7ce4cdaa2dd1cacc70426c
confirmations
140538
spent
true